Understanding Mobile Phone Signal Boosters
A mobile phone signal booster also known as a signal repeater, is a device designed to amplify weak cellular signals. It captures existing signals from nearby cell towers, strengthens the signal, and redistributes it within a specific area. This technology is particularly useful in environments with weak signal reception, such as remote locations, rural areas, or buildings with thick walls that obstruct signals.
Why Do You Need a Mobile Phone Signal Booster?
Several factors can contribute to poor mobile signal quality:
- Geographical Location: People living in rural areas may find themselves far from cell towers, leading to inadequate coverage.
- Physical Barriers: Buildings made of concrete or metal can interfere with signal transmission, causing dead zones in homes or offices.
- Network Congestion: In urban areas, cell towers can become overloaded during peak usage times, resulting in dropped calls or slow data speeds.
A mobile phone signal booster can address these issues by boosting the signal strength, providing users with better connectivity for calls and data.
How Does a Mobile Phone Signal Booster Work?
The operation of a mobile phone signal booster can be broken down into three main steps:
1. Signal Capture
The first step involves capturing the existing weak mobile signal from the nearest cell tower. The booster includes an external antenna that is usually installed in a high location, such as on a roof or a high window. This antenna is designed to collect signals from cell towers in the vicinity effectively.
2. Signal Amplification
Once the signal is captured, it is sent to an internal amplifier within the booster. This component is responsible for increasing the strength of the signal. The amplifier boosts the weak signal using various electronic components to ensure it is powerful enough for redistribution.
3. Signal Redistribution
After amplification, the boosted signal is sent to an internal antenna, which redistributes the improved signal throughout the area, such as your home or office. This enables devices within the coverage area to experience enhanced signal quality, making calls clearer and data connections faster.
Types of Mobile Phone Signal Boosters
Mobile phone signal boosters come in different types, catering to various needs:
1. Single-Operator Boosters
These boosters are designed to work with only one mobile network operator. If you primarily use a single network and are aware of the frequency bands it utilizes, a single-operator booster may be the right choice for you.
2. Multi-Band Boosters
Multi-band boosters can handle signals from several cellular frequency bands. If you or your household members use different operators, a multi-band booster is ideal, as it accommodates multiple networks and ensures you all stay connected.
3. Long-Range Boosters
These models are designed to capture signals from greater distances, making them suitable for homes located far away from cell towers. Long-range boosters can significantly enhance signal reception in rural areas.

Installation of a Mobile Phone Signal Booster
Installing a mobile phone signal booster can seem complex, but many models are designed for straightforward setup. Here are the steps typically involved:
- Choose the Right Location for the External Antenna: Finding a high point where signal strength is best is crucial for optimal performance.
- Install the Internal Amplifier: Place the amplifier in a central location within your home or office to ensure even distribution of the signal.
- Establish Connections: Connect the external antenna to the amplifier, and then connect the amplifier to the internal antenna.
- Testing the Setup: After installation, test the signal strength in various areas of your home to ensure the system is working correctly.
